Arrapaho

Country: Italy, Language: Italian, 98 mins

  • Director: Ciro Ippolito
  • Writer: Silvano Ambrogi; Ciro Ippolito
  • Producer: Ciro Ippolito

The(ir) Blurb...

Scella Pezzata, daughter of the Indian chief Heavy Ball of the Cefaloni tribe, is betrothed to Cavallo Pazzo, but is in love with Arrapaho, son of the Indian chief Mazza Nera of the Arrapaho tribe, who is in turn the object of Luna Caprese's wishes of the Froceyenne tribe.
